Some major tech firms still can't program their software to deal with leap days

Three people working on a problem at a PC screen.
(Image credit: Shutterstock)

A whole raft of software failing on the 29th of February, from Citrix' virtual machine software, to Sophos Server, to self-service petrol pumps in New Zealand, once again proved that programmers still have no contingency plan to deal with Leap Day.

The New Zealand Herald (via Ars Technica), noted that petrol pumps across the country were out of action for ‘more than ten hours’ due to the bug, which affects New Zealand first due to where it is in the world - or, more thrillingly, the magic of spacetime.

Bleeping Computer reported issues with Citrix and Sophos products as they were happening, with Citrix advising users to change the date manually on their systems while disabling the automatic date change function in their operating system. Sophos Server and Endpoint users, meanwhile, ran into issues with SSL and TLS certificate warnings, which depend on system time synchronization, and were advised, simply, to turn SSL/TLS decryption off for the day.

Leap Day calendar sorcery

 Leap days happen because, although the year as defined by the Gregorian calendar is 365 days long, it takes 365.24 days for the Earth to orbit the Sun - so, every four years, an extra day is added to the calendar so that the average length of a year matches up.

But despite Leap Day being something that you can literally set your watch to, companies somehow still end up in this mess every time. Humans have always been procrastinators, really - 1999 was a big year for computer programmers figuring out how to stop planes from falling out of the sky on January 1st, 2000 despite having had years to figure it out.

And although John Scott, CEO of Invenco Group, the company that provides the affected self-service terminals across New Zealand, said that it was looking into what caused the New Zealand-specific glitch, one oil company representative, from greenhouse gas behemoth Allied Petroleum, seemed less moved to act when asked about it on Facebook, which is obviously the right forum for it.

We’re reliant on tech - so where’s the urgency?

“We’ll add it to our Outlook reminders [quizzical emoji]”, said the poor, inveigled social media intern. So, they’re making a joke, right, but if you follow the thought, it’s emblematic of the fact that every four years we end up here, and it’s just accepted as a fact of life. The intern may be having fun, but you can bet the executives at oil companies were actively pupating over every lost bit of business this year, four years ago, eight years ago, and so on, so it’s anyone’s guess as to why this keeps happening.

Anyway, it’s March now, so we’ll see you in four years.

More from TechRadar Pro

Luke Hughes
Staff Writer

 Luke Hughes holds the role of Staff Writer at TechRadar Pro, producing news, features and deals content across topics ranging from computing to cloud services, cybersecurity, data privacy and business software.

Read more
A Windows 11 laptop sitting on a desk in front of a window
Microsoft warns its January Windows updates may fail if this Citrix software is installed
Representational image of a hacker
The 10 worst software disasters of 2024: cyberattacks, malicious AI, and silent threats
Microsoft
10 tech anniversaries you shouldn't miss in 2025
Internet outage
Nearly all companies expect a major outage in 2025
Flag of the People's Republic of China overlaid with a technological network of wires and circuits.
One of the biggest flaws exploited by Salt Typhoon hackers has had a patch available for years
A young man working on laptop in office writing notes
Ending the fix/break cycle of End User Computing support
Latest in Pro
A person in a wheelchair working at a computer.
Why betting on Mac security could put your organization at risk
Finger Presses Orange Button Domain Name Registration on Black Keyboard Background. Closeup View
I visited the world’s first registered .com domain – and you won’t believe what it’s offering today
Racks of servers inside a data center.
Modernizing data centers: an efficient path forward
Dr. Peter Zhou, President of Huawei Data Storage Product Line
Why AI commonization is so important for business intelligent transformation and what Huawei’s data storage has to offer
Wix automation
The world's leading website builder aims to save businesses time with new tool
Data Breach
Thousands of healthcare records exposed online, including private patient information
Latest in News
Google Pixel 8a in aloe green showing
Google Pixel 9a benchmark link teases the performance of the upcoming mid-ranger
Quordle on a smartphone held in a hand
Quordle hints and answers for Monday, March 17 (game #1148)
NYT Strands homescreen on a mobile phone screen, on a light blue background
NYT Strands hints and answers for Monday, March 17 (game #379)
NYT Connections homescreen on a phone, on a purple background
NYT Connections hints and answers for Monday, March 17 (game #645)
Apple iPhone 16 Pro HANDS ON
Leaked iPhone 17 dummy units may have given us our best look yet at all four models
A super close up image of the Google Gemini app in the Play Store
It's official: Google Assistant will be retired for phones this year, with Gemini taking over